Cefathiamidine Specification

The IUPAC name of Cefathiamidine is 3-(acetyloxymethyl)-7-[[2-[N,N'-di(propan-2-yl)carbamimidoyl]sulfanylacetyl]amino]-8-oxo-5-thia-1-azabicyclo[4.2.0]oct-2-ene-2-carboxylic acid. With the CAS registry number 33075-00-2, it is also named as 7-(alpha-((N,N'-Diisopropylamidino)thio)acetylamino)cephalosporanic acid. The product's classification code is drug / therapeutic agent. Moreover, its molecular formula is C19H28N4O6S2 and its molecular weight is 472.58. 

The other characteristics of Cefathiamidine can be summarized as: (1)ACD/LogP: 2.67; (2)# of Rule of 5 Violations: 1; (3)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 0.17; (4)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 0; (5)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 1; (6)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 1; (7)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 2.13; (8)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 1.44; (9)H bond acceptors: 10; (10)H bond donors: 3; (11)XLogP3: 0.5; (12)Tautomer Count: 4; (13)Exact Mass: 472.145026; (14)MonoIsotopic Mass: 472.145026; (15)Heavy Atom Count: 31; (16)Complexity: 811; (17)Freely Rotating Bonds: 10; (18)Polar Surface Area: 159.42 Å2; (19)Index of Refraction: 1.652; (20)Molar Refractivity: 118.47 cm3; (21)Molar Volume: 323.6 cm3; (22)Polarizability: 46.96×10-24cm3; (23)Surface Tension: 54.8 dyne/cm; (24)Density: 1.45 g/cm3.

The toxicity data is as follows:

Organism Test Type Route Reported Dose (Normalized Dose) Effect Source
mouse LD50 intraperitoneal 1260mg/kg (1260mg/kg)   Chinese Medical Journal Vol. 92, Pg. 26, 1979.
mouse LD50 intravenous 720mg/kg (720mg/kg)   Chinese Medical Journal Vol. 92, Pg. 26, 1979.
